Honda CR-V Review Summary
"loaded with nifty features and...its all-around practicality and comfort deserve high marks."
"...split-folding rear seatbacks can be reclined, a rare feature in any vehicle."
"...a great combination of a car-like ride and interior with truck-like visibility and ground clearance."
"Its extra cargo room offers some of the usefulness of a minivan... For all its engaging detail touches, though, the most endearing trait of the CR-V interior is its roominess "
"...some nifty gadgets, like a flip-up tray table and a folding picnic table in the rear."
What reviewers liked least about the Honda CR-V:
"Power window switches, located on the dashboard to the left of the steering wheel, are a bit awkward when underway."
"...every one of our drivers hates (yes, it's a strong word) the squareback-chair driving position."
Honda CR-V Comparisons:
"Then again, those new competitors both come from a Ford factory whose previous products have been significantly less reliable than the nearly fault-free CR-V."
"It holds 26 beer cases, one fewer than the Escape/Tribute."
"...among the four-cylinder SUVs, the CR-V is the best."
"Although the CR-V's four-cylinder engine is smooth and does an adequate job, it seems lethargic next to the V-6 in the new Mazda Tribute and Ford Escape twins."

You should be aware that when reviewing 2004 Honda CR-V reviews, what is said regarding a vehicle can typically be applied to the entire generation. A generation is made up of similar vehicles from one year to the next. When a vehicle undergoes a redesign, it is considered a new generation.
Also, when looking at 2004 Honda CR-V reviews, you should take them with a grain of salt. Like all people, reviewers may have a bias towards a manufacturer or particular car. That’s why it’s best to examine opinions from several sources.
